WebUsing the sharp point, apply light pressure to the skin. At minimum, test the shoulders, arms and legs, comparing side to side and proximal to distal areas. In any area where the patient complains of sensory loss or hypersensitivity, more detailed testing may be required. Light touch:

Web25 aug. 2024 · Symptoms. Meralgia paresthetica may cause these symptoms affecting the outer (lateral) part of your thigh: Tingling and numbness. Burning pain. Decreased sensation. Increased sensitivity and pain to even a light touch. These symptoms commonly occur on one side of your body and might intensify after walking or standing. WebTouch. The sensory function of touch involves sensing surfaces and their textures and qualities. It is tested with the pinprick test and the light touch test. Both tests should be demonstrated to the patient first. With the pinprick, the therapist gently touches the skin with the pin or back end and asks the patient whether it feels sharp or blunt.
